Message type: E = Error
Message class: RP - Error Messages for Infotype Module Pools
Message number: 026
Message text: Next pay scale increase coincides with 'from' date of record
The <ZH>Next Increase</> date coincides with the validity from date of
the record. However, this date should lie after the validity from date
of the record.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Check your entries.

- Next pay scale increase coincides with 'from' date of record ?The SAP error message RP026, which states "Next pay scale increase coincides with 'from' date of record," typically occurs in the context of payroll processing when there is an issue with the pay scale data for an employee. This error indicates that the system has detected a conflict between the scheduled pay scale increase and the effective date of the employee's current pay scale record.
Cause:
Pay Scale Increase Timing: The error usually arises when the next scheduled pay scale increase is set to take effect on the same date as the 'from' date of the current pay scale record. This can happen if the pay scale increase is not properly configured or if the employee's record is not updated to reflect the new pay scale.
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ration of the pay scale structure or the rules governing pay scale increases.
Data Entry Errors: Incorrect data entry when setting up the employee's pay scale records can also lead to this error.
Solution:
Review Pay Scale Records: Check the employee's pay scale records in the system. Ensure that the 'from' date of the current pay scale record does not coincide with the date of the next scheduled pay scale increase.
Adjust Dates: If the dates are conflicting, you may need to adjust the 'from' date of the current pay scale record or the date of the next pay scale increase to ensure they do not overlap.
Check Pay Scale Configuration: Review the configuration of the pay scale increases in the system. Ensure that the rules for pay scale increases are set up correctly and that they align with the organization's policies.
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or your organization's payroll policies for guidance on how to handle pay scale increases and related records.
Testing: After making adjustments, run a test payroll to ensure that the error is resolved and that the employee's pay scale is processed correctly.
